Copy National Pokédex Entries from Pokémon Bank to Pokémon Home:

A Complete Guide

Did you know that you can copy your National Pokédex progress from Pokémon Bank to Pokémon Home? Entries you have registered in your Bank Pokédex can be automatically registered in your Home National Pokédex too - even if you don't have those actual Pokémon stored in Bank or Home. The only requirement is a Home account with an active premium subscription. This guide provides step-by-step instructions for how to perform the transfer.

If you do NOT have a working 3DS with Pokémon Bank installed, start at step 4!

  1. Update your in-game Pokédex: Ensure that the desired species and forms have been registered in your game(s) of X/Y, Omega Ruby/Alpha Sapphire, Sun/Moon, and/or Ultra Sun/Moon.
    Some Pokédex entries are automatically unlocked in the Pokédex as soon as you own the relevant species. Other entries require you to use a form in battle at least once. To ensure everything will sync properly, you should use any Pokémon form you want to register in a battle; any wild encounter will do. Remember to save afterwards!
  2. Sync your in-game Pokédex and your Bank account: Bank's Pokédex updates itself using your Pokédex progress in the main series games (not which Pokémon you deposit into Bank). Log in to Bank and deposit any Pokémon. Save and exit.
  3. Look at your Bank Pokédex: Log in to Bank again. Open the Pokédex menu and browse through it. Make sure that you've registered everything you wanted!
    Next, open the Adventure Records menu and look at some of your game records. Then save and exit again.
    Viewing both the Pokédex AND the Adventure Records is important to ensure that all Bank Pokédex entries will sync to Home. If you skip this step, random entries might fail to transfer! Seems weird, but this is a real issue and solution I've personally tested to confirm.
  4. Sync your Bank Pokédex and your Home account: Log in to Home using either the Switch or mobile app. Select the Move Pokémon From Bank menu option. Transfer any Pokémon from Bank to Home. Your Pokédexes will sync during the transfer.
  5. You're done! Check out your Home National Pokédex after the transfer is finished. Any entries you had unlocked in Bank should now be unlocked in Home too.
